    BK> mauede at alice.it wrote:
    >> I wonder whether there is a more gentle way to stop an R
    >> script running on top of JGR aother than ... unplugging
    >> the power cord.

    BK> there must be a bug in JGR on Lunux. Clicking the stop
    BK> button should stop the script, clicking it here on my
    BK> linux machine will immediately crash R together with JGR
    BK> altogether. Unfortunately JGR still seems to be the best
    BK> (and only) available shell/editor combination available.

not at all!

How much is available depends on the platform,
but the first one that has been available for all platforms,
even before R existed, is  
     ESS  ( http://ess.r-project.org/ ),
an acronym for "Emacs Speaks Statistics".

But there are quite a few others (I do not really know from
personal experience), see, e.g.,
all the projects (listed on the left hand side) of
    http://www.r-project.org/GUI
